Taylor Swift is a pretty big thing, and so are the World Cup champions. The US Women’s National Team, already in New York City for their incredibly successful celebration parade this morning to recognize them for a World Cup victory, they made their way across state lines for some nightlife fun. The women joined Taylor Swift on stage at MetLife Stadium in East Rutherford, NJ and brought the World Cup trophy with them much to the glee of the crowd. Concertgoers screamed loudly for the players, who waved two American flags and sang along to Swift's hit song. They also brought their trophy and let the singer hold it. "I wanna hold it one more time," Swift said. They huddled like a team at the end of the performance, and the audience chanted "U.S.A." after they exited. Good luck recovering from Taylor Swift’s two-night run at MetLife Stadium. Appearances from The Weeknd, the U.S. Women’s National Soccer Team and her “Bad Blood” squad left fans reeling, but one guest performer got Swift all sentimental. On Saturday night, she brought out Nick Jonas to perform his hit song, “Jealous.” Jonas and Swift have known each other for years, and back in 2009 she performed “Should’ve Said No,” off her 2008 self-titled debut album, in the Jonas Brothers’ concert movie, Jonas Brothers: The 3D Concert Experience. On Sunday, Swift posted a throwback photo from that performance next to one from Saturday’s, igniting all the feels.

Taylor Swift kicked off the first of two 1989 World Tour dates in Chicago with more than one surprise for fans. On Saturday, July 18, she invited Andy Grammer and Empire actress Serayah to perform with her in front of a sold-out crowd at Soldier Field -- and, as a delighted Chance the Rapper revealed via Instagram, she also spent some time with him while she was in town. Swift and Grammer performed a duet of ‘Honey, I’m Good,’ Grammer’s most recent single. “Everrrybody knew the words and it was SO MUCH FUN,” Swift reported.
